Why won’t my Toshiba Fire TV remote work?

Before delving into the troubleshooting steps, let’s identify some of the typical reasons your Toshiba Fire TV remote might stop working:

  1. Battery Depletion: The most common culprit is depleted batteries. Over time, the batteries lose their charge, causing the remote to become unresponsive.
  2. Connection Problems: Occasionally, the remote may lose its connection with the TV. This can happen due to interference or other electronic devices using the same frequency.
  3. Software Glitches: Updates or software issues can sometimes disrupt the functionality of the remote control.
  4. Physical Damage: Drops or spills can damage the remote, rendering it non-functional.

How to Fix Toshiba Fire TV Remote Not Working

If you are experiencing issues with your Toshiba Fire TV remote not working, there are a few troubleshooting steps you can try to resolve the problem:

Solution 1: Replace the BatteriesToshiba Fire TV Remote Not Working

Firstly, ensure that the batteries in the remote are not low or exhausted. Replace them with new batteries:

  1. Open the battery compartment on the back of your remote.
  2. Remove the old batteries and replace them with fresh ones. Make sure they are inserted correctly, following the polarity markings.
  3. Close the battery compartment and try using the remote.

Next, make sure that there are no obstructions between the remote and the TV, as this can interfere with the signal. Additionally, check if there are any sources of interference nearby, such as other electronic devices, and move them away from the TV.

Solution 2: Re-Pair the Remote

Pair the remote with the TV as following instructions:

  1. Navigate to “Settings” on your Toshiba Fire TV.
  2. Select “Controllers & Bluetooth Devices” and then “Amazon Fire TV Remotes.”
  3. Find your remote in the list and select it.
  4. Follow the on-screen instructions to re-pair the remote with your TV.

Solution 3: Restart Your Toshiba Fire TV

  1. Go to “Settings” on your TV.
  2. Scroll down and select “My Fire TV.”
  3. Choose “Restart.”
  4. Once your TV reboots, try using the remote again.

Solution 4: Power Cycle The TV and The Remote

If the remote still doesn’t work, try restarting both the TV and the remote. Turn off the TV from the power source and unplug it for a few minutes.  Remove the batteries from the remote and press all the buttons to discharge any remaining power. After the reset, plug the TV back in, turn it on, and insert the batteries into the remote.

Solution 5: Check for Software Updates

  1. Access the “Settings” menu on your Toshiba Fire TV.
  2. Select “My Fire TV” and then “About.”
  3. Click on “Check for Updates.”
  4. If an update is available, follow the on-screen instructions to install it.

Solution 6: Clean Your Remote

Sometimes, dust and debris can interfere with the remote’s functionality. Clean your remote by gently wiping it with a soft, lint-free cloth.

Solution 7: Contact Toshiba Customer Support

If none of the above solutions work, it’s possible that your remote has a hardware issue. Contact Toshiba customer support for further assistance and potential replacement options.

How can I use Toshiba Fire TV without a remote?

If you find yourself without a remote for your Toshiba Fire TV, don’t worry – there are still ways to use your device. One option is to use the HDMI-CEC (Consumer Electronics Control) feature, which allows you to control your Fire TV using your TV’s remote. To enable this feature, make sure your Fire TV and TV are connected via HDMI, then navigate to the Settings menu on your Fire TV. From there, select the Display & Sounds option, followed by the HDMI CEC Device Control option. You can then enable the feature and use your TV remote to control your Fire TV.

Another way to control your Toshiba Fire TV without a remote is to download and use the Fire TV app on your smartphone or tablet. This app acts as a virtual remote control, allowing you to navigate through menus, access apps, and control playback on your Fire TV. Simply download the app from your device’s app store, ensure your device is connected to the same Wi-Fi network as your Fire TV, and follow the prompts to pair the app with your TV. With this app, you can enjoy all the functionality of a physical remote right at your fingertips.

Can a universal remote work on a Toshiba Fire TV?

A common question that arises when dealing with a Toshiba Fire TV is whether a universal remote can be used with it. The good news is that yes, a universal remote can work on a Toshiba Fire TV. These remotes are designed to be compatible with a wide range of devices, including smart TVs like the Toshiba Fire TV. However, it is important to note that not all universal remotes are the same. Some may require programming or additional setup steps to be performed before they can be used with the Toshiba Fire TV. When you need a replacement for your Toshiba Fire TV remote, you have several options to consider:

  1. Official Toshiba Replacement: Contact Toshiba customer support or visit their official website to purchase a genuine replacement remote specifically designed for your TV model.
  2. Amazon: Amazon offers a wide selection of Toshiba Fire TV remote replacements, including both official and third-party options. Ensure compatibility with your TV model before purchasing.
  3. Universal Remotes: Universal remotes are versatile and can often be programmed to work with Toshiba Fire TVs. Brands like Logitech Harmony and GE offer universal remotes that may suit your needs.
  4. Electronic Retailers: Visit electronic retail stores, such as Best Buy or Walmart, to explore their selection of remote controls. They typically carry a range of options for various TV brands.
  5. Online Marketplaces: Websites like eBay and Newegg often have listings for Toshiba Fire TV remote replacements, both new and used. Be sure to read product descriptions and check seller ratings for reliability.
  6. Smartphone Apps: Some Toshiba Fire TV models allow you to control your TV using a smartphone app. Download the official Amazon Fire TV app or other compatible remote apps from your device’s app store.
  7. Local Electronics Stores: Visit local electronics or appliance stores in your area. They may carry replacement remotes or be able to order one for you.

Before purchasing a replacement remote, verify its compatibility with your Toshiba Fire TV model to ensure it functions correctly.

How do I reconnect my Fire TV remote?Toshiba Fire TV Remote Not Working

To reconnect your Fire TV remote, follow these simple steps. First, press and hold the Home button on the remote for at least 10 seconds. This will reset the connection between the remote and your Toshiba Fire TV. After resetting, check if the remote is working properly. If not, try removing the batteries from the remote, waiting for a few seconds, and then reinserting them. This can sometimes help to establish a better connection. If none of these steps work, you may need to replace the remote or contact Toshiba customer support for further assistance.

FAQs about Toshiba Fire TV Remote Not Working

Why is my Toshiba Fire TV remote not responding at all?

The most likely cause is depleted batteries. Try replacing them and reattempting. If that doesn’t work, follow the other solutions outlined in this article.

What if my Toshiba Fire TV remote is not connecting to my TV?

Re-pairing the remote with your TV, as explained in Solution 2, should resolve the issue. Make sure to follow the on-screen instructions carefully.

How often should I replace the batteries in my Toshiba Fire TV remote?

Battery life can vary depending on usage, but it’s a good practice to replace them when you notice decreased responsiveness. This could be every few months or longer.

Can I use a universal remote with my Toshiba Fire TV?

Yes, you can use a compatible universal remote. Just make sure it’s compatible with your Toshiba Fire TV model.

How do you reset a Toshiba Fire TV remote?

To reset your Toshiba Fire TV remote, press and hold the Home button, Back button, and the left side of the navigation circle simultaneously for about 10 seconds. This will reset and re-pair the remote.

Why is my Fire TV not responding to the remote?

If your Fire TV isn’t responding to the remote, start by checking the batteries. Ensure they are correctly inserted and have charge. If the issue persists, try re-pairing the remote in the Fire TV settings.

How do I get my Toshiba Fire TV remote to work?

To get your Toshiba Fire TV remote working, replace the batteries with fresh ones, ensuring they are correctly aligned. If the problem persists, re-pair the remote in the TV settings or consult Toshiba customer support for assistance.
